JOHN REES: Where Now for the Egyptian Revolution?
After the exhilaration of the Egyptian uprising, the dictator has gone but the dictatorship remains. Mubarak's administration is still in place, with the army holding the reigns of power, led by Field Marshall Tantawi, who Wikileaks revealed recently is regarded by the United States as "Mubarak's poodle".
This public meeting, organised by Stop the War Coalition and the Egyptian Liberation Initiative, brings together Egyptian speakers, Tony Benn, Jeremy Corbyn MP, human rights lawyers Louis Christian and others to discuss where now for the Egyptian revolution.
